Subject: [PATCH] scsi: ufs: make ufshcd_print_trs() consider UFSHCD_QUIRK_PRDT_BYTE_GRAN

Fix ufshcd_print_trs() to consider UFSHCD_QUIRK_PRDT_BYTE_GRAN when
using utp_transfer_req_desc::prd_table_length, so that it doesn't treat
the number of bytes as the number of entries.

@@ -474,6 +474,9 @@ void ufshcd_print_trs(struct ufs_hba *hba, unsigned long bitmap, bool pr_prdt)
prdt_length = le16_to_cpu(
lrbp->utr_descriptor_ptr->prd_table_length);
+ if (hba->quirks & UFSHCD_QUIRK_PRDT_BYTE_GRAN)
+ prdt_length /= sizeof(struct ufshcd_sg_entry);
+
dev_err(hba->dev,
"UPIU[%d] - PRDT - %d entries phys@0x%llx\n",
tag, prdt_length,
